Living martyr Kayastha passes away

KATHMANDU, May 11: Mukesh Kayastha, the wounded 'living martyr' of the second mass movement, has passed away. Mukesh Foundation mentioned that he passed away at Shir Memorial Hospital in Banepa at 8 pm on Wednesday during his treatment.

Kayastha, who was a 'living martyr' for 17 years after being injured in the mass movement, died at the age of 32. Injured by security personnel during the protest on April 9, 2006. The bullet hit Kayastha's wrist. He was only 14 years old at that time.
